Prunus yedoensis, commonly known as the Yoshino cherry, is celebrated for its profuse white blossoms in early spring. This deciduous tree grows to approximately 5 metres tall with a broad, spreading canopy. It thrives best in full sun and well-drained soil, tolerating frost and cooler climates common in New Zealand.

Why Choose Prunus yedoensis Yoshino Cherry?

If you crave a tree that signals the start of spring with a spectacular floral performance, the Prunus yedoensis yoshino cherry is an ideal pick. With its abundance of semi-double blooms covering bare branches, this cherry creates a magical, ethereal look before the fresh green foliage emerges. Not only does it attract pollinators such as bees, but its gently spreading form casts light dappled shade, ideal for underplanting with shade-tolerant perennials.

The Prunus yedoensis is easy to grow in most well-drained soils, thriving in full sun to part shade. It's moderately fast-growing and develops an appealing vase-shaped silhouette as it matures. In autumn, the foliage transforms to shades of yellow and gold, extending its garden appeal well past flowering.

Planting and Care Tips

To get the best from your Prunus yedoensis yoshino cherry, choose a position with ample sunlight and shelter from strong prevailing winds. Plant in well-drained, fertile soil and water regularly during drier periods in the first few years. Apply a balanced, slow-release fertiliser in early spring to boost flowering performance.

Minimal pruning is required—remove only dead, damaged, or crossing branches in late summer to maintain the tree’s stunning natural shape.
